    Rack heat question

    I am about to buy a combo rack from Animal Plastics that holds 15qt tubs as well as 32qt tubs. When they put the flexwatt on these I assume it runs longways across each shelf....so the 15qt tubs will have heat at one end and cool at the other end...but the 32qt tubs will have heat running along one of the long sides of the tub rather than at the end. Does this allow for a proper heat gradient in the 32qt tubs? It seems like the cool side might run too hot since it is so close to the hot side.
